Dermot O’Leary Bio

Dermot O’Leary, born Sean Dermot Fintan O’Leary, Jr. was born on the 24th of May 1973 in Essex, England and is a British-Irish television host and radio presenter. With a radio career that started with time on Essex Radio, he went on to be a presenter at Channel 4 and presented Big Brother’s Little Brother from 2001 onwards.

In 2007, O’Leary became the host of X Factor, where he remained for eight years as a fan favourite host, after a brief hiatus he came back to the show to acclaim. As a radio jockey, O’Leary currently presents the breakfast show BBC Radio 2.  In television his most recent hosting jobs include the BRIT Awards and Children in Need as well as This Morning.
